The differential equations of motion of the restricted three-body problem with decreasing mass are deduced under the assumption that the satellite mass varies with respect to time. The Jeans law and the space-time transformation contrast are applied to the Meshcherskii (1975) transformation. It is noted that the space-time transformation is applicable only in the special case where n = 1, k = zero, and q = 1/2. The equations of motion for the present problem differ from the equations of motion of the restricted three-body problem with constant mass only in the existence of small perturbing forces.
